DOT regulations establish strict guidelines for drug and alcohol screening to ensure the safety of employees in regulated industries. In Gibbs, TN, these regulations help maintain a drug-free environment, promoting public and workplace safety by reducing accidents and fatalities.
All DOT-regulated companies in Gibbs, Tennessee must implement a comprehensive drug and alcohol testing program. This includes pre-employment, random, and post-accident testing, designed to deter and detect substance abuse among employees.
Employee safety is a priority in DOT regulations, and failure to comply can lead to severe penalties and increased insurance premiums. Employers in Gibbs, TN are encouraged to foster a zero-tolerance policy to ensure compliance with these regulations.

In Gibbs, TN, FMCSA regulations mandate drug and alcohol testing to ensure roadway safety. All drivers must pass pre-employment tests before operating commercial vehicles.
Random testing under FMCSA rules in Gibbs, Tennessee ensures ongoing compliance, reducing the risk of accidents caused by impairment on the road.

USCG rules in Gibbs, TN mandate drug and alcohol testing to enhance maritime safety. These measures are critical for operating vessels responsibly.
Compliance with USCG testing regulations in Gibbs, Tennessee aids in preventing substance-related incidents at sea, preserving crew and passenger safety.

FAA regulations in Gibbs, TN ensure aviation safety with mandatory drug testing for safety-sensitive positions. Compliance is crucial for public confidence.
The FAA's drug and alcohol testing rules in Gibbs, Tennessee help prevent workplace incidents by maintaining a drug-free environment for airline staff.

Railway operators in Gibbs, TN adhere to FRA drug and alcohol testing rules, aiming to preserve rail safety for both employees and the traveling public.
By implementing FRA guidelines, rail companies in Gibbs, Tennessee encourage a secure and efficient work environment through regular drug testing.

FTA regulations in Gibbs, TN require rigorous drug and alcohol testing to protect public transit safety. Adherence to these rules helps prevent accidents.
Employees in Gibbs, Tennessee working under FTA policies must participate in regular screenings to mitigate risks and ensure passenger safety.

Gibbs, TN follows PHMSA guidelines to ensure transit and pipeline safety through rigorous drug and alcohol testing practices. Employee compliance is essential.
Transportation companies in Gibbs, Tennessee must enforce random drug testing policies to meet PHMSA standards, upholding public security.

To arrange any DOT drug or alcohol test in Gibbs, TN, contact our scheduling at (800) 221-4291 or use our online express registration. Complete the Donor Information section before visiting the testing center.
Enter your zip code to locate the closest DOT testing center for your selected test near Gibbs, Tennessee. A donor pass detailing the local center address, hours, and instructions will be emailed; have it handy at the center. Most cases do not require an appointment, but registration and payment are required upfront.
Our labs are SAMHSA-certified, and an in-house licensed physician, an MRO, verifies all results.
